WHAT WE'RE LOOKING FOR: The MDS Coordinator (LPN, RN) is responsible for overseeing the resident assessment and care planning process and ensuring compliance with federal and state regulations related to resident assessments, quality of care and Medicare/Medicaid reimbursement. Key ResponsibilitiesConduct and complete the Minimum Data Set (MDS) assessment to evaluate residents’ physical, psychological and functional status, including the implementation of Care Area Assessments (CAA)s and triggers.Evaluate each resident’s condition and pertinent medical data to determine any need for special assessment activities or a need to amend the admission assessment.Prepare and electronically transmit timely reports to the national Medicare and Medicaid databases.Develop a written plan of care (preliminary and comprehensive) for each resident that identifies the problems/needs of the resident and the goals to be accomplished for each problem/need identified.Provide information to residents/families on Medicare/Medicaid and other financial assistance programs available to the residents.Ensure that MDS notes are informative and descriptive of the services provided and of the residents’ response to the service.Assist with completing the care plan portion of the residents’ discharge plan. Evaluate and implement recommendations from established committees as they pertain to the assessment and/or care plan functions of the health campus.Qualifications Must have and maintain a current, valid state LPN or RN licenseThree (3) to five (5) years’ experience working in the MDS or assessment role in a senior residential care, healthcare, senior living industry or long-term care environment, preferredCurrent, valid CPR certification requiredCompensation will be determined based on the relevant license or certification held, as well as the candidate’s years of experience.
